Mathematics : if one divisor of a dividend is greater than the square root of the dividend, then the quotient is smaller than the square root of the dividend.

We have ij = n,
i > 0, j > 0

if i > sqrt(n)
ij > sqrt(n) j
n > sqrt(n) j
sqrt(n) > j

Hence we have to check the primality of a number by trying to divide it only upto the square root of the number.
